Transaction 2bb529fa921dd45541214f63d439650c97c7fbc6c44079e362d564c7f9463ce0

1 Input
2 Outputs
  • 2bb529fa921dd45541214f63d439650c97c7fbc6c44079e362d564c7f9463ce0:0
  • value  38412055
    address  1PbyKMQaroaYga8p452tRnBr6jy9RB2rBy
  • 2bb529fa921dd45541214f63d439650c97c7fbc6c44079e362d564c7f9463ce0:1
  • value  27314361923
    address  15PhhzZR7wkzVoPVp9xFriB32NayFUHjFJ